Return-Path: X-Original-To: notmuch@notmuchmail.org Delivered-To: notmuch@notmuchmail.org Received: from localhost (localhost [127.0.0.1]) by olra.theworths.org (Postfix) with ESMTP id 131A7431FAF for ; Wed, 28 Mar 2012 14:41:33 -0700 (PDT) X-Virus-Scanned: Debian amavisd-new at olra.theworths.org X-Spam-Flag: NO X-Spam-Score: -2.29 X-Spam-Level: X-Spam-Status: No, score=-2.29 tagged_above=-999 required=5 tests=[RCVD_IN_DNSWL_MED=-2.3, T_MIME_NO_TEXT=0.01] autolearn=disabled Received: from olra.theworths.org ([127.0.0.1]) by localhost (olra.theworths.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id P8brLRVImu-g for ; Wed, 28 Mar 2012 14:41:32 -0700 (PDT) Received: from outgoing-mail.its.caltech.edu (outgoing-mail.its.caltech.edu [131.215.239.19]) by olra.theworths.org (Postfix) with ESMTP id A9A98431FAE for ; Wed, 28 Mar 2012 14:41:32 -0700 (PDT) Received: from earth-doxen.imss.caltech.edu (localhost [127.0.0.1]) by earth-doxen-postvirus (Postfix) with ESMTP id 36A9B66E0186 for ; Wed, 28 Mar 2012 14:41:32 -0700 (PDT) X-Spam-Scanned: at Caltech-IMSS on earth-doxen by amavisd-new Received: from finestructure.net (DHCP-123-229.caltech.edu [131.215.123.229]) (Authenticated sender: jrollins) by earth-doxen-submit (Postfix) with ESMTP id 7BCEC66E00EF for ; Wed, 28 Mar 2012 14:41:30 -0700 (PDT) Received: by finestructure.net (Postfix, from userid 1000) id 5643DB4; Wed, 28 Mar 2012 14:41:30 -0700 (PDT) From: Jameson Graef Rollins To: Notmuch Mail Subject: bug in emacs reply code for References headers User-Agent: Notmuch/0.12+75~gb2dcc3c (http://notmuchmail.org) Emacs/23.3.1 (x86_64-pc-linux-gnu) Date: Wed, 28 Mar 2012 14:41:27 -0700 Message-ID: <87iphos8s8.fsf@servo.finestructure.net> MIME-Version: 1.0 Content-Type: multipart/signed; boundary="=-=-="; micalg=pgp-sha256; protocol="application/pgp-signature" X-BeenThere: notmuch@notmuchmail.org X-Mailman-Version: 2.1.13 Precedence: list List-Id: "Use and development of the notmuch mail system."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 28 Mar 2012 21:41:33 -0000 --=-=-= Hi, folks. I just wanted to make people aware of a bug in the new reply code (new JSON reply format) on the current master. It appears that newlines are not placed after the References header is inserted, which means that the User-Agent header gets concatenated at the end of the References line, causing malformed References. I have been able to get around this by adding the newline in manually in the reply buffer. But it is easy to not notice, and the bug may destroy subsequent threading. Adam Wolfe Gordon, the original author of the new JSON reply code, was made aware of this on IRC and I believe he is looking into the issue. In any event, those using master and the emacs UI should aware of this issue. jamie. --=-=-= Content-Type: application/pgp-sign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.12 (GNU/Linux) iQIcBAEBCAAGBQJPc4WHAAoJEO00zqvie6q8nawP/iDg+ftI26pwOeVGMUTkG3Z0 MzFtF+ai+YRJA35wVzWBfm8NcFTaqxxulhPytXU8eiSYVW2SxFWh2mchn0/tufG5 aO5xo5Nz6JPDm7Wz1v7yUumVp1wV+1TkkamdxnCC35LvhdPisNwtb/IiIUEAsL3P qQXdrgeMAodIh8XiOEMoLdJkIFy7TW6ajclgiPi2BVDiju40obWeiRet/IxmjFH+ 6Op0je5WBsSyTZqre17n/mQSC5fDQS4VF/GdoX7r244/eIAZMPKGZitVc8hboomR zxnNclPXaPgu0eWz0+6ADFe92K3q/8qUrSLdxjpE6q2U/kuqdjJhZvOO0RCioLYZ v6EfGXwEdfcX/fW491b1QCuEW/aXBA/7jq6v5nExWtrROrWDpJkLUxuKj0mr6jlM pYuC/cjqxRdGKFX1dpjkUo9b3to3W6K6mDhXuO8hod1XyL0KqFAE6Te19VR2bWLr SO3/cALGK4/9Oj6PayZBO68VGQuejOI4AeZnFB4YB++k6fHb0c0cHVzLzptrk9sA W4Cs2oA8iIQvoYWvy3dCia4BD0nhsmxjoiJnj+zT4WwUMH8OKtJqS/vx4Vy+izFP wS8C1/UZXFwT8ebmBz6aND364gcCcOGdZZEwnYL8SmqYIl8qJ9G/gmkOkHKVSISP 1ppeFfWhXqPgqdQTIni+ =Q7zY -----END PGP SIGNATURE----- --=-=-=--